
Sharing Good Practice in MSOR Teaching and Learning
The CETL-MSOR Conference 2012 is being held in partnership with the Higher Education Academy and will take place in the Halifax Conference Facility, Endcliffe Village, University of Sheffield on Thursday 12 to Friday 13 July 2012.
The aim of this conference is to promote, explore and disseminate emerging good practice and research findings in Mathematics and Statistics support, teaching, learning and assessment. In particular it will provide an opportunity to share experiences from the wide variety of activities supported by the National HE STEM Programme through the Mathematical Science HE Curriculum programme and sigma. The conference will appeal to all those teaching Mathematics, Statistics or Numeracy, whether this is to specialist mathematics students or students studying components of mathematics within their degree programmes (such as bioscience, chemistry, computer science, economics, engineering, nursing, physics, psychology, social work, etc).
